Popularity of the name AVALUNA since 1880.

Number of births per year since 1880.

According to recent statistics from the United States, the name Avaluna has been gaining popularity over the past two years. In 2021, there were six babies named Avaluna, and this number remained consistent in 2022 with another six births registered that year.

While still a relatively rare name, with only twelve total births recorded since 2021, it's noteworthy that all of these occurrences have taken place within the past two years. This suggests that parents may be discovering and choosing Avaluna as a unique option for their newborns, leading to its recent emergence on the baby naming scene in America.
